    Navel piercing remove
    Hi, I have my belly done for 4 months and it develps scar tissue ,that s why I decided to remove the ring and get it repierce when it closes up,but I have a big purple lump on my belly,can you tell me how to get rid of it because I don't want to pierce over the ugly scar and also how long can I get it redone?thanks

    The big purple lump sounds like it could be a keloid. Does the lump itself hurt at all? Keloids (which is the term for large scars) can be purplish or grayish in color. How big would you say the lump is?

    To get rid of the keloid, you need to see your doctor and talk to him about steriod injections. You get the injection once a month and usually see results after about 3 injections. Unfortunately, there is no home remedy for keloids.

    Now if you do get the injections and see some improvement, I would still recommend that you do not get it re-pierced. If your body is prone to keloids, which it sounds like it may be, then it is a good chance that it will just come back. You don't want to have to go through this over and over again just for a piercing, its not worth it. Good luck! :)
